body {margin:0px; font-family: Georgia, Trebuchet MS, Arial; background-color:#fff; color: #000; font-size: 8pt; line-height: 11pt;}
a:link, a:visited {color:#ccc; text-decoration: none; font-weight: bold;}
a:hover {text-decoration: none; color: #000;} 

ul {padding: 0px; margin: 0px; list-style: none;}

.assinatura {font-size:7pt; color:#bababa; float:right; padding-right:2px; margin:0 0 20px 0;}
a.assinatura:link, a.assinatura:visited {font-size:7pt; color:#bababa; }
a.assinatura:hover {font-size:7pt; color:#333; }

#mainCell {margin: 10px 30px 10px 30px; width: 960px; text-align: left; width:96%;}
#cabecalho { text-align: left; border-bottom: 2px dotted #000;}
#nomeAutor { font-size: 55pt; line-height: 68pt;}


/* --- lista de publicações --- */
div.publicacao {margin: 20px 10px 20px 0;  float: left; width: 280px; text-align: left;}
.publicacao li{ display:block;  padding-bottom:10px; }
a.publicacao, a.publicacao:visited  {color: #ccc; margin-bottom: 50px;}
a.publicacao:hover { color: #000; }
a.publicacao.Selected {color: #000; }


/* --- texto resumo ou citação da publicação --- */
#ctResumoPublicacao {float: left;  margin: 20px 0 20px 0; vertical-align: top;}
div.aspasLeft {width: 55px; vertical-align: top;float: left; }
div.Resumo {width: 560px;  float: left;}
div.aspasRight {width: 55px; float: left; padding-top: 140px; text-align: right; }
div.citadorResumo { text-align: right; font-weight: bold; font-size: 7pt; margin: 10px 0 5px 0; font-style: italic; }

